Chelsea were prime movers in the 1970s punk explosion. Keen to articulate their anger at the economic and political climate of the day, Gene October and his band were ferociously confrontational, and picked up a following who mirrored the band's attitude to life. This concert was recorded in Blackpool, England, and includes the songs "Right To Work," "Rockin' Horse," "Evacuate," and many more.
Streetpunk rules with this rare performance from the early London punk outfit Chelsea at Blackpool's infamous Bier Keller venue in 1984. The DVD was released by Cherry Red Records, an independent label established in 1978 that prides itself on releasing obscure material from all forms of U.K. punk and rockabilly acts from the '70s onward. ---Jeremy Wheeler, Rovi |
